The Sylvania 21916 FO40/841/XP/ECO3 Octron 800 XP Ecologic 5-Foot T8 Fluorescent Lamp is a high-output linear fluorescent replacement tube engineered for commercial and industrial relamping projects requiring ANSI C78.81 compliance. Operating at 40 watts with a 4100K cool white correlated color temperature and 85 CRI, this extra-long 60-inch T8 lamp delivers 3,750 initial lumens and 3,525 mean lumens, making it ideal for high-ceiling office complexes, retail environments, schools, and cold-storage display cases. The Octron 800 XP Ecologic series is built with reduced mercury content and is compatible with both magnetic rapid-start ballasts designed for 265 mA T8 operation and high-frequency electronic instant-start, rapid-start, or programmed rapid-start ballasts.

ADL Supply Expert Application & Replacement Guide

When retrofitting existing T12 or older T8 installations, verify that the ballast is rated for 265 mA T8 operation per ANSI C78.81 standards. Please note that this is a specialized 5-foot (60-inch nominal) linear tube; it will not fit standard 4-foot commercial fixtures. Magnetic rapid-start ballasts must be specifically designed for 40W T8 lamps; do not install on standard F40T12 magnetic ballasts. For electronic ballast retrofits, confirm the ballast factor falls between 0.71 and 1.20 at nominal input voltage. In instant-start configurations, bridge the two socket contacts together per National Electric Code techniques and ensure minimum open-circuit voltage of 550V RMS. In cold-storage or freezer applications below 60°F, expect potential striation or brightness reduction—this is non-damaging and will resolve once ambient temperature stabilizes. For 3-hour cycle operation, rated life is 36,000 hours; extending operating cycles yields proportional life increases.

Operation, Safety & Mounting Compliance

Ballast Compatibility & Electrical Requirements

This lamp must be operated only with magnetic rapid-start ballasts designed for 265 mA T8 lamps, or high-frequency electronic ballasts that are instant-start, rapid-start, or programmed rapid start specifically designed for T8 operation. When operated in instant-start mode, the two wires or contacts of each socket must be connected together and then to the appropriate ballast lead wire using National Electric Code techniques. Ballast factors must range from 0.71 to 1.20 at nominal input voltage. SUPERSAVER lamps require F32T8 ballasts with minimum open-circuit voltage of 550V RMS. Not recommended for remotely ballasted fixtures below 550V open-circuit voltage, rapid-start ballasts below 570V, air-handling fixtures, low power factor ballasts, or inverter-operated emergency systems unless specifically listed.

Warm-Up & Restrike Operation

Approximate initial lumens are measured after 100 hours of operation. Mean lumens are measured at 40% of average rated lamp life. Minimum starting temperature is a function of the ballast; consult the ballast manufacturer for low-temperature starting specifications. If an operating lamp is exposed to drafts or ambient temperature falls below 60°F (70°F for 25W variants), striation (a rhythmic pulsing pattern running down the tube) and/or brightness reduction may occur. This behavior is not damaging to the lamp; removing the cause returns the lamp to normal operation.

Operating Cycle & Life Rating

Life ratings are based on 3-hour operating cycles under specified conditions with ballasts meeting ANSI specifications. If the operating cycle is increased, there will be a corresponding increase in average hours of life. Do not operate on dimming circuits unless the ballast is explicitly rated for T8 dimming.
